Weak current engineering construction project management is an important link in the work of the construction unit. According to the requirements of ISO900 1 engineering quality specification, it includes many aspects, among which construction management, technical management and quality management are outstanding.

A, construction management

Engineering construction is a comprehensive management work, the key lies in its coordination and organization, including the management content of other professions. Its main contents are as follows:

1. The construction schedule management determines the organization of construction personnel, the supply of equipment, the schedule of weak current engineering, civil engineering and decoration engineering during the whole construction period. Usually, it must be checked and managed by establishing a project schedule. The preparation of weak current construction schedule is based on the construction sequence, which mainly includes the following stages, namely, building installation drawing design (deepening secondary design), pipeline construction, equipment (incoming goods) acceptance, equipment installation, debugging, initial opening and acceptance.

2. Construction Interface Management The central content of construction interface management is the division and coordination of weak current system engineering construction, electromechanical equipment installation engineering and decoration engineering construction, especially there are many interfaces between intelligent building management system, electromechanical equipment and independent subsystems. Generally, management is carried out by means of dispatching meetings held by project leaders of each subsystem, and a document reporting system is established, and all measures are recorded, modified and coordinated in writing.

3. The organization and management of construction should reasonably arrange the number of project managers, technicians, installation workers and commissioning engineers during the construction of weak current system and the time for these personnel to enter the site, so as to avoid unnecessary labor waste and increase labor costs. This kind of management needs to be closely combined with the construction schedule management, and a strong construction team should be organized in stages to complete the construction tasks at this stage on time with good quality and quantity.

Second, the engineering technology management

1. Technical Standards and Specifications Management Weak current system engineering should be carefully checked in the process of system design, provision and installation, and compared with relevant standards and specifications, so that the whole management is under control.

2. The installation process management of weak current engineering is a highly technical and technical work. To do a good job in the technical management of the whole weak current project, it is mainly to master the technical conditions of installation equipment and the technical requirements of installation technology in each construction stage. On-site engineering and technical personnel should strictly check, record any situation that does not conform to the specifications and design documents or the contents that have been modified on site during the construction process, and establish technical management files and materials for the final overall debugging and opening of the system.

3. Technical document management The technical documents of weak current system engineering are the same basis for the implementation of each stage of the project. These folders mainly include construction drawings, design descriptions, relevant technical standards, product manuals, debugging outlines of subsystems, acceptance specifications, functional requirements and acceptance standards, etc. These technical documents need systematic and scientific management. In order to provide complete and correct technical documents to engineering management personnel in time, a series of regulations on receiving and sending, copying, modifying, submitting, keeping, borrowing and keeping confidential technical documents have been established.

Third, quality management.

Engineering quality management is a comprehensive reflection of the work of weak current construction units. The implementation of ISO900 1 system engineering quality system should run through the whole project implementation process of weak current system, and the following quality links should be truly grasped:

1. Construction drawing standardization and drawing quality standards;

2. Quality inspection and supervision of pipeline construction;

3. Review wiring specifications and quality requirements;

4. Quality inspection and supervision of wiring construction;

5. Quality inspection and supervision of field equipment or front-end equipment;

6. Quality inspection and supervision of master control equipment;

7. Fill in and check the intelligent weak current system monitoring parameter setting table;

8. Audit and implementation of debugging outline and quality supervision;

9. Parameter statistics and quality analysis during system operation;

10. Steps and methods of system acceptance;

1 1. System acceptance and quality standards;

12. Specification requirements for system operation and operation management;

13. Specifications and requirements for system maintenance and repair;

14. Annual inspection records and system operation summary, etc.

When understanding the above links to ensure the high quality of the system, quality control, quality inspection and quality evaluation should be done well.
